Good News.
The New Everton Stadium has been put forward for the bid for the 2028 Euro;s.

Everton Stadium Shortlisted In UK And Ireland EURO 2028 Bid
Latest news from Everton Football Clubwww.evertonfc.com
We definitely stand a good chance.Probably worth mentioning it's part of a list of 14 which will be reduced to 10.
Not too confident they'll keep ours as they won't want upset the other countries.
1. Liverpool Everton Stadium
2. Birmingham Villa Park
3. London London Stadium
4. London Tottenham Hotspur Stadium
5. London Wembley Stadium
6. Manchester City of Manchester Stadium
7. Newcastle St James' Park
8. Sunderland Stadium of Light
9. Trafford Old Trafford
10. Dublin Dublin Arena
11. Dublin Croke Park
12. Belfast Casement Park Stadium
13. Glasgow Hampden Park
14. Cardiff National Stadium of Wales
